Nb 4 Te 17 I 4 , a New Pseudo One‐Dimensional Solid‐State Polytelluride

The new ternary compound Nb4Te17I4 has been prepared and structurally characterized. It crystallizes in the monoclinic system, space group C2/c with unit-cell parameters a = 16.199(4), b = 8.128(2), c = 27.355(6) A, β = 110.84(2)°, Z = 4. The structure consists of infinite one-dimensional niobium/tellurium chains running parallel to the crystallographic c direction. The chains are separated by iodine atoms. Short and long metal–metal distances alternate in the sequence of three consecutive short bonds ([d ≈ 3.1 – 3.2 A) and one long (d = 4.268 A) metal–metal separation. Each Nb atom is eight-coordinate. The composition of the chain is ∞11[(Nb5+)2(Nb4+)2(Te22−)4(Te32−)3(I−)4].
